A String Hoppers Machine is a kitchen appliance used to make a traditional South Indian delicacy called String Hoppers, also known as Idiyappam. It is a simple device that consists of a cylinder-shaped press with small holes at the bottom and a container to hold the dough. The dough is made from rice flour and water and is fed into the cylinder-shaped press. By pressing the dough through the small holes at the bottom, thin strands of rice flour noodles are formed, which are then steamed and served with a variety of curries or chutneys. The String Hoppers Machine is a quick and easy way to make this delicious and healthy South Indian dish at home.

Here are the basic steps for using a String Hoppers Machine:

  1. Prepare the dough: Mix rice flour and water to make a soft dough. Knead the dough well to make it smooth and free of lumps.
  2. Fill the container: Open the lid of the machine and fill the container with the prepared dough.
  3. Press the dough: Close the lid and apply pressure to the container by turning the handle. This will push the dough through the small holes at the bottom of the press, forming thin strands of noodles.
  4. Collect the noodles: As the noodles come out of the press, collect them in a plate or a steamer basket.
  5. Steam the noodles: Once you have enough noodles, place them in a steamer basket and steam them for a few minutes until they are cooked through.
  6. Serve: String Hoppers can be served with a variety of curries, chutneys, or coconut milk. Enjoy!

Note: Make sure to follow the manufacturer’s instructions for your specific String Hoppers Machine for best results.
